reorganise

网络  重新组织; 重组; 翻译记忆库; 改组

过去分词:reorganised 现在分词:reorganising 过去式:reorganised 第三人称单数:reorganises

双语例句

  • What is also new is that the Internet has made it possible radically to reorganise production across borders.
    新还体现在,因特网使跨国界的生产重组变得极有可能。
  • Reorganise tax fees& Green Taxation promote the sustainable use of resources
    整合税费绿化税制DD促进我国资源可持续利用
  • However, given that Germany has so far rejected this option, the alternative needs to be a simple programme that rewards prudent debt levels, while providing a space for errant sovereign states to reorganise their finances.
    但由于德国迄今一直拒绝这种方案,因此替代方案必须简单易行,既对维持审慎债务水平的国家予以褒奖,又为犯了错误的国家重振财政提供一定的空间。
  • A broader move to reorganise fund management structures and adjust management incentives could drive enormous change.
    如果采取更广泛的举措,重组资金管理机制,调整管理层激励政策,那将会产生十分巨大的变化。
  • Mr Hynes said he could understand that after weeks of preparing the printed Annual Report, companies might be reluctant to reorganise the information for an online version.
    海恩斯表示,他可以理解,在为准备打印版年报忙碌了数周之后,企业或许不愿意重新组织信息,再弄一个网上版本。
  • Instead, you need to reorganise the information in some way whether by making notes of your notes, thinking about how what you're reading relates to other material, or practising writing answers.
    相反,你需要以某种方式重组信息-无论是根据已有的笔记做笔记,思考你读的东西怎样关联到其他材料,还是练习写出答案。
  • But over the six weeks since his arrest and detention, the French political elite, particularly on the left, have overcome their initial shock and begun to reorganise for a world without Mr Strauss-Kahn.
    但在他被拘和监禁的6周内,法国政治精英,尤其是左翼,已克服了最初的震惊,开始适应一个没有卡恩的世界。
  • It was especially disappointing because it came at a time when we had to reorganise our defence when Jamie Carragher had to leave the field.
    这非常的失望因为当我们从新组织防线时卡拉格不得不离开球场。
  • The group will reorganise its Hong Kong-related fixed-line, broadband, television and mobile businesses into a new entity called HKT Group Holdings.
    电讯盈科将其香港固话、宽带、电视以及移动业务,重组成一家名为hktgroupholdings的新公司。
  • Policy makers have high hopes that the likes of ecommerce giant Alibaba, search engine Baidu and social media powerhouse Tencent will help to reorganise markets, connecting supply more efficiently with demand.
    政策制定者对电商巨头阿里巴巴、搜索引擎百度和社交媒体巨擘腾讯寄予厚望,希望它们帮助重新组织市场、更有效地对接供给与需求。
